How they compare
Rwanda currently reports 12.93 years against 12.35 years in UNICEF: All Unicef Countries, a difference of 0.58 years.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 38 shared years of data; in 1971 it was UNICEF: All Unicef Countries ahead.
Rwanda ranks 115th and UNICEF: All Unicef Countries ranks 116th of 186 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Rwanda averaged higher in 1 and UNICEF: All Unicef Countries in 5.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Rwanda | UNICEF: All Unicef Countries |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 3.65 years | 8.08 years | 4.42 years | UNICEF: All Unicef Countries |
| 1980s | 5.3 years | 8.37 years | 3.07 years | UNICEF: All Unicef Countries |
| 1990s | 5.54 years | 8.63 years | 3.09 years | UNICEF: All Unicef Countries |
| 2000s | 9.37 years | 9.69 years | 0.319 years | UNICEF: All Unicef Countries |
| 2010s | 11.42 years | 11.48 years | 0.0606 years | UNICEF: All Unicef Countries |
| 2020s | 12.59 years | 12.31 years | 0.2874 years | Rwanda |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
